STAVANGER, Norway --StatoilHydro has contracted CHC Helicopter Service for a new search and rescue helicopter to serve the Troll/Oseberg operations in the North Sea.

The EC225 Super Puma aircraft is part of a range from Eurocopters introduced in 2004. It has a maximum range of 987 km (613 mi) and a fast cruise speed of 278 kph (173mph). For evacuation purposes, it can accommodate patients on 12 stretchers, with six seated casualties, and can withstand a maximum sling load in rescue mode of 11,200 kg (30,000 lb).

The helicopter will be stationed at the Oseberg field center, with a similar aircraft based in Bergen acting as a reserve for both Troll/Oseberg and the Tampen area fields. The contract is effective from Oct. 2008 through May 2016, with optional extensions of up to four years.
